Robin in the woods at Bolton Abbey
This is a viewpoint high above the river Wharfe, close to the Strid, at Bolton Abbey. There's a bench just next to it, but I prefer to sit on the ground further back to watch the birds that hop around the area picking up seeds.
Camera/lens settings: ISO 200, f/4.8, 1/250s, 150mm, hand held.
